Skip to content

Merge pull request #5023 from NewAgeAirbender/ca_bills #129

Merge pull request #5023 from NewAgeAirbender/ca_bills

Merge pull request #5023 from NewAgeAirbender/ca_bills #129

Workflow file for this run

name: Build and push California Docker image
on:
push:
branches:
- main
tags:
- '*'
paths:
- "pyproject.toml"
- "poetry.lock"
- "Dockerfile.california"
- "scrapers/ca/*"
- "scrapers_next/ca/*"
- ".github/workflows/ca-docker.yml"
jobs:
publish: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v3
- name: Login to Docker Hub
uses: docker/login-action@v2
with:
username: ${{ secrets.DOCKER_USERNAME }}
password: ${{ secrets.DOCKER_PASSWORD }}
- name: build california docker image
uses: docker/build-push-action@v3
with:
context: .
file: Dockerfile.california
tags: "openstates/scrapers-california:latest,openstates/scrapers-california:${{ github.sha }}"
push: true